how can I get a floor plan view of my accurender rendering?

I would recommend a perspective view looking down from above.  If you must, you can use an orthographic 3d view, but perspectives generally work better.

 

Either exclude blocking objects from the view using AutoCAD-- for example, by freezing layers-- or use clipping planes.  Below are two threads which discuss clipping planes-- the second one has a plan-like rendering:

I've found if you use the acad dview and adjust the lens length (zoom) to minimize the perspective effect, then save the view. Set that view to current in ACAD and Open the walkabout window in Nxt and set that to the current Acad view. If you set up a ACAD clipping plane just below ceiling level I believe it will still pick up the interior lighting correct as well.
